How many horsepower is a 6.4 liter Hemi?

410 horsepower
6.4L Heavy-Duty HEMI® V8 Getting its name from the hemispherical combustion chambers found atop each cylinder head, the HEMI® uses variable-cam timing (VCT) and boasts 410 horsepower and 429 lb. -ft. of torque.

What is the difference between a 5.7 Hemi and a 6.4 Hemi?

The 6.4 HEMI generally offers an extra 75-100 horsepower over the 5.7 engine. Thanks to larger displacement the 392 is also good for an extra 60-80 lb-ft. Low-end torque is also about 70 lb-ft more than the 5.7 further widening the gap between the two.

How much horsepower does a 6.4 L 392 Hemi have?

485 hp @ 6,100 rpm
In 2015, the 6.4L/392 HEMI engine got a bump in horsepower to 485 hp @ 6,100 rpm, while torque was increased to 475 lb. -ft.

Is a 6.4 L V8 fast?

6.4-liter HEMI V8 powered by SRT This engine produces 485 horsepower and 475 lb-ft of torque and helps the Dodge Charger to accelerate from 0-60 mph in the low four-second range and hit a top speed of 182 mph.

What’s the difference between the 6.2 and 6.4 Hemi?

The bore and stroke of the 6.2L HEMI engine measures 4.09 inches and 3.58 inches. For comparison, the bore and stroke on a 6.4L/392 HEMI engine comes in at 4.09 inches and 3.72 inches.

Does 6.4 Hemi need premium gas?

Does 6.4 Hemi Need Premium Gas? According to the owner’s manual, 89 is recommended, 87 is acceptable. Premium offers no added benefit.

Is a 392 HEMI a hellcat?

The 2021 Durango SRT Hellcat is powered by the one-and-only Hellcat 6.2-liter supercharged V8 engine that makes 710 horsepower and a whopping 640 lb-ft of torque. On the other hand, the 2021 Durango SRT 392 is powered by a 6.4-liter naturally aspirated V8 that generates 475 horsepower and 470 lb-ft of torque.
